Anyhow, this article talks about how keyboards (QWERTY or otherwise) are the bottleneck between us and LLMs, and how it would be far faster convey context and instructions to LLMs via our voices than a keyboard.
A friend of mine was fond of saying the real bottleneck on human communication is the speed of thought. He'd say that whenever we'd discuss more direct brain-computer interfaces. In that vein, I wonder if producing more tokens with speech would actually yield more information for LLMs or just more noise.
